Staff from the First Student bus company introduce kids to the experience of riding the bus. After a short storytime inside the library, we'll head to the Horizon Park parking lot to visit a school bus. Pose for a photo in the driver's seat and even honk the horn.

TR = Ticket registration. Free tickets distributed 30 minutes before the program on a first-come, first-served basis at the Youth Services Desk.
